Package-level declarations

Types

Link copied to clipboard
data class FilePublication(val fileName: String, val content: String)
Link copied to clipboard
class GitHubPublisher(githubToken: String, owner: String = "embabel", repo: String = "publications", commitMessage: String = "Published by Embabel Agent") : Publisher
Link copied to clipboard
data class PublicationRequest(val publications: List<FilePublication>)
Link copied to clipboard
data class PublicationResponse(val resources: List<PublishedLocation>)
Link copied to clipboard
data class PublishedLocation(val url: String)
Link copied to clipboard
interface Publisher